Jason Jaworski - Two Winters Long - signed

EDITION 100 + 5 APs / 15 x 18 cm / 168 PAGES / transparent softcover with hand dripped wax dots
 
price: 28€
 
 
 
 
 
Completed in sequence in early 2016, Two Winters Long is Jason Jaworski’s most recent published photographic project, comprised entirely of images created within the 2015 winter season. Originally begun as a separate project while the artist was working in Cambodia teaching art at an NGO to orphans, the images were soon collected and sequenced together with others created at different locations from the artist’s winter travels including New York, Los Angeles, Tijuana, San Francisco, San Ysidro, Oahu and Scranton.
 


 
Jason Jaworski - Thinking of You - signed

54 LOOSELEAF CARDS / 5,7 x 9 cm / 2nd edition of 250 /
 
price: 25€
 
 
 
 
 
A culmination of a half-decade of work created across numerous countries on both sides of the globe, Thinking Of You intertwines a complex range of personal projects into one, including the performance based photography of Jason Jaworski’s 1000 Miles project created in collaboration with MOCA, the process based images from his project SEA which had him developing his negatives with ash from a bomb site in Mexico City, the site-specific wandering from Rome Alone where he followed employees of several counterfeit factories in Taiwan and had his work printed at them, to the documentary theater of LABYRINTH where the artist followed a gang of little people through different slums in the Philippines where they created set pieces and scenes to act out for the camera.
